Question Sending virus files to AWIL Software

Hi people, i want to send some files to AWIL software so that they are aware and can update the virus definations, but everytime i go into the chest and select the said file or files i get a message that the SMTP settings need to be configured, anyone know what these are? I have looked on their support forums, but cant find anything, and i have tried Google.

Im using Avast 4.7 Home Edition.

Re: Sending virus files to AWIL Software

First things first, are you sure it's a virus? If so, how? If you're certain, then I would submit it to Virus Total and see what you get back

http://www.virustotal.com/en/indexf.html

If other vendors identify it as being infected yet Avast doesn't, then submit it via email. According to their COntacts page (http://www.avast.com/eng/how-to-cont...-software.html)
Quote:
Originally Posted by avast.com
To send suspected virus/malware files, please use virus@avast.com.
HTH

Re: Sending virus files to AWIL Software

I have virus files stored in the Chest that i wish to send.

---------- Post added at 16:03 ---------- Previous post was at 15:43 ----------

Its ok i sussed it, i had to tick "SMTP Server Requires Authentication" and then enter the details of my email account, i was sending from.
